Haight AshburyView south from the grandstand at Ewing Field, now the site of Ewing Terrace, toward Turk St. Built for the San Francisco Seals baseball team, it opened May 16, 1914. The building at center, built as Presentation Convent in 1912, still stands in 2021 (without the cupola) at Turk and Masonic. Trees of Calvary Cemetery at left across Masonic Avenue. A sign in left field reads 'Ten Dollars Reward for the arrest and conviction of cushion throwers'
Lone MountainElevated view southeast across Market at McAllister toward streetcar accident between 2 Market Street Railway cars 7-line #119 and 21-line #1502. The outbound 7-line streetcar split a switch while turning onto McAllister. 4 pedestrians were injured. near Clinton Cafeteria, 1059 Market Street.
